Designed by
Title
Christmas Lights Display on Duke of York, London UK #81311540
Description
LONDON - NOVEMBER 26, 2016: Christmas Lights Display on Duke of York Square just off the fashionable King`s Road in Chelsea, London, a lovely pedestrianized area just off Sloane Square
This image is editorial